The Neighborhood:
Topsham is a vibrant and charming town on the Exe Estuary, and this cottage offers the perfect base for exploring everything it has to offer. Centrally located, the cottage is less than five minutes’ walk to the estuary, the High Street, pubs, restaurants, and the train station, making it ideal for both a car-free stay or further adventures.
Enjoy beautiful walks along the Goat Walk or the Exe Estuary Trail, which stretches to Exmouth and Exeter - perfect for cycling or scenic strolls. A 15–20-minute walk takes you to Dart’s Farm, a popular shopping and food destination with local produce, boutique stores, and a kids’ play area (the best fish and chips around!). The Topsham Ferry across to the Turf Locks pub is a must-do, especially on sunny afternoons.
Food lovers will be spoilt for choice: enjoy curry at Denley’s, sourdough pizzas at South West Pizza Co, or fine dining at The Galley and The Salutation Inn. The town’s pubs offer atmosphere and variety, from riverside views at The Passage House Inn and The Lighter Inn, to local ales at The Globe and the award-winning Bridge Inn. The Topsham Wine Cellar is perfect for wine, charcuterie, and relaxed evenings.
For breakfast or coffee, head to Sarah’s Petite Cuisine, Route 2, or the quirky Circle 2 plant-and-coffee shop. Don’t miss the Saturday market at Matthews Hall for artisan treats and local crafts.
With frequent trains and buses to Exeter, Exmouth, and Sandy Park rugby stadium, plus estuary views, independent shops, and a warm community feel, Topsham offers the perfect mix of relaxation and activity. Whether you’re walking, dining, shopping, or simply enjoying the estuary breeze, there’s something here for everyone.
Getting Around:
The property is centrally located within Topsham and benefits from being easy walking distance to local amenities and travel connections. The train station is only 5 minutes walk away and there is a bus stop (#57 to Exeter or Exmouth) across the road from the cottage. The train runs approximately every 30 minutes with connectivity to Exmouth, Exeter, and Sandy Park rugby field. Plus you can secure bikes to the drainpipe in the courtyard to the rear (shared but only with a few other residents). So it's a very convenient property if you don't have a vehicle.
For those that do drive, there are several parking options available. Topsham operates resident parking zones from 9am to 5pm every day, which we can provide permits for at a cost of £5/day. There are also two other paid car parks: High Street - charges from 9am to 5pm, £5.50/day, or Holman Way - charges from 8am to 6pm, £5.00/day.
